The blocked current can make a vibration in the electromagnetic field inside the light bulb or inside the switch, which can produce a buzzing noise. Rather than dimming the light bulb, the dimmer switch actually causes the current to flicker super fast so that to our eyes, it seems that there is a smaller amount of light. The sound is created by cutting up the AC current traveling between the dimmer and the light bulb. Some of the older dimmers make a buzzing or humming sound, that can be annoying.
